Subject: Calendar sync conflict resolution — Plannora connector

Hi Westgate integration team,

The conflict you reported occurs when both Plannora and your connector update the same event within the sync window. Our resolver now uses last-writer-wins keyed on the upstream modification timestamp, not receipt time, which should eliminate the duplicate-event churn. Please review the changed merge logic in the sync-conflict branch before we tag a release. For conflict-replay testing against our staging calendar, use the token below.

portal login ticket: eyJhbGciOiJIUzI1NiIsInR5cCI6IkpXVCJ9.eyJzdWIiOiIwEOsktwVNwIn0.-UJU3fdyyCgG

Subject: Baseline file is yours now (sort of)

Hey, welcome aboard! Quick heads-up: the lint baseline for the Quillbranch repo (baseline.sarif) just changed hands. You'll regenerate it after each sprint, but don't approve shrinkage or growth yourself — every diff needs a thumbs-up first. Rule of thumb: new suppressions require justification comments. If anything looks weird, route questions to the person listed below.

named custodian: Brivan Eliath Quenox Frador

## Provenance: Log Sampling in Chattermill

Quick note for security review: Chattermill is extremely chatty, so we sample debug logs at 1% before shipping them off-box. Sampling config is baked into the image at build time — no runtime overrides, so nobody can quietly crank it to zero. The token for the reviewed build is below.

build token for kagaf-hahof: htk14_9d3d4d26d7d8de

For the finance team: the Q3 review of the Norbury and Ellsmere regions is complete. Norbury finished 7% above target, driven largely by renewals on the Trelise suite, while Ellsmere missed by 11% owing to delayed procurement cycles at two anchor accounts. We recommend reallocating one field position and adjusting the Ellsmere forecast downward by 4% for Q4, pending Marguerite's validation of pipeline data. Please model both scenarios before the planning session, noting the confidential item appended below.

confidential, kagep-kahof: Druokax Systems plans to lower the Ulaath list price by 53 percent in March.